Garmin Forerunner 310XT — 3.7V Li-ion Replacement Battery (361-00041-00)
This is a 3.7V 600mAh Li-ion cell that replaces part number 361-00041-00 in the Garmin Forerunner 310XT multisport GPS watch. It fits the 310XT directly — no modifications needed. Use the capacity figure from this listing; aftermarket cells vary and this one matches the original specification.
- Forerunner 310XT fit: The 310XT uses a single flat Li-ion cell with a specific connector orientation and BMS handshake tied to the watch's charge management IC. Swapping to a cell outside the original voltage and physical footprint causes the watch to reject the charge cycle entirely.
- Bench tested on actual hardware: We ran this cell through the 310XT's charge IC and confirmed the BMS handshake completed without fault flags. The cell accepted a full charge cycle and the watch powered on to the GPS acquisition screen without error.
- Cold-start GPS initialisation after swap: After fitting this cell, power the watch on outdoors and let it acquire a satellite fix before your first session. Full power removal triggers a cold start — first fix takes 5–10 minutes. Subsequent warm starts run under a minute once GPS almanac data is re-cached.
Why the 310XT shuts off without warning during a run
The 310XT reads battery percentage from a voltage curve calibrated to the original cell. When the installed cell ages and its discharge curve flattens, the watch misreads remaining charge. The BMS cutoff voltage threshold gets hit before the on-screen indicator drops to a low-battery warning. Fitting a fresh cell restores the correct voltage curve and gives the charge indicator accurate headroom again.
GPS accuracy dropping toward the end of a long session
At low state of charge, the 310XT's power management reduces current available to the GPS receiver module. Lower receiver sensitivity means the unit drops weaker satellite signals, reducing fix quality and position accuracy. This shows up as erratic pace readings or track points jumping off the route. A fully charged fresh cell keeps the receiver running at full sensitivity — check that the cell voltage reads 4.1–4.2V off the charger before a long session.
